Which type of solution will cause cells to swell, or even to burst?

Answer:

(b) Hypotonic solution

Explanation:

  • Any solution having lower osmotic pressure as compared to another solution is called as a hypotonic solution and the reason that a solution is hypotonic is that it has more water and lesser dissolved solute in it.
  • If a cell is placed in a hypotonic solution, the amount of water content in the cell would be lesser as compared to that of the solution and hence, the water will enter the cell due to which the cell will swell and may even burst.
  • The water molecules can enter the cell through the semipermeable membrane and in case of plant cells, the presence of cell wall may prevent it bursting, however, the animal cells lack the cell wall and hence if kept in hypotonic solution for long these cells may burst.
